Teen girl killed in Colorado River collision identified; boater arrested

The California teenager killed in a weekend collision on the Colorado River in Bullhead City, Arizona, has been identified as Guadalupe Rodriguez of San Bernardino.

The 13-year-old girl died of spinal fractures, the Mohave County medical examiner said.

Bullhead City police spokeswoman Carina Spotts said Rodriguez and her 8-year-old sister were on a personal watercraft operated by their mother when they were struck by a 20-foot boat near the beach at Davis Camp early Saturday afternoon. The younger girl and mother were transported to hospitals for treatment of fractures and lacerations.

The uninjured boat operator, Kevin Morgan, 42, Long Beach, California, was arrested and charged with operating a watercraft while intoxicated. A manslaughter charge is possible as the investigation continues.
